- Switzerland
- http://175.24.133.176:3885/mental-health-test0386
-
Discover the importance of mental health with our comprehensive Mental Health Assessment Form. Easily assess your mental well-being and take control of your health.
- Joined on
2025-10-28
Block a user
Sort